Scouting news

Boy Scouts in Troop 52, chartered to First United Methodist Church, took first place in the overall competition at the Pelathe District Glacial Glutes campout Feb. 16-18 at the Fraternal Order of Police Campground in Douglas County. Scouts attending were patrol leader Andrew Denny, Conner Smith, Wesley Tedlock, Brendan Golledge, Doug Rawlings and Henry Reiske. They were accompanied by adult leaders Chris Golledge, Rowley Tedlock, Richard Rawlings and Mike Pierson.

¢Boy Scout Troop 53, chartered to Christ Community Church in Lawrence, conducted its annual Winter Court of Honor on Feb. 12. Boys receiving a rank advancement were Patrick Liston and Tommy Nissen, Scout; Alex Clabaugh, Tenderfoot; Connor Chestnut and Luke Lesslie, Second and First Class; and Alex McKinsey, First Class. Connor Chestnut, Zach Chumbley, John Hambleton, David Teefey and Jordan Yulich earned merit badges since the last Court of Honor. Ryan Pennington was elected the troop’s senior patrol leader, replacing John Chumbley, who had served since September.

¢Cub Scout Pack 3462, chartered to Langston Hughes School’s PTO, conducted its sixth annual Blue and Gold Banquet on Feb. 9 at First United Methodist Church’s West Campus.

Webelos II Scouts receiving the Arrow of Light Award, the highest achievement in Cub Scouting, were Diamond Brockway, Vail Moshiri, Thomas Peterson, Hunter Ross, AJ Ware, Garrett Weeks and Dakota Zinn. Diamond, Vail, Thomas, Hunter, Garrett and Dakota participated in a bridging ceremony and were welcomed as new members of Troop 52. AJ was welcomed as a new member of Troop 53.
